INFORMATION/CONSENT CALENDAR: - It is recommended that Items 1 through 4 be acted on simultaneously unless separate discussion and/or action are requested by a council member. 1. SUBJECT: Minutes of the special and regular meetings of November 4, 2014. RECOMMENDED ACTION: Accept the minutes as submitted. 2. SUBJECT: City of Galt Warrants. RECOMMENDED ACTION: Approve the warrants as submitted. 3. SUBJECT: Approval of the Project and Expenditure Plan and Transportation Development Act Claim for Fiscal Year 2014-2015. RECOMMENDED ACTION: 1) Adopt a resolution to approve the Project and Expenditure Plan and claim for Transportation Development Act Funds for Fiscal Year (FY) 2014-15; and 2) Authorize the Public Works Director to submit any necessary additional amended claim forms to the Sacramento Area Council of Governments (SACOG) for Local Transportation Funds and State Transit Assistance Funds for FY 2014- 2015. 4. SUBJECT: Mobile computer replacements for police department. RECOMMENDED ACTION: Authorize the Information Technology Manager to initiate the purchase of mobile computers and any necessary mounting components using the $35,000 designated for computer upgrades through the previously approved Measure R Expenditure Plan (Resolution No. 2014-36). RECOMMENDED ACTION: Approve the consent calendar as presented. F. SCHEDULED MATTERS G. REGULAR CALENDAR: CITY ATTORNEY’S OFFICE: 1. SUBJECT: Amendment of Galt Youth Committee Ordinance and Bylaws. STAFF REPORT: Rudolph RECOMMENDED ACTION: 1) Introduce an ordinance amending Chapter 2.85 of the Galt Municipal Code regarding the Galt Youth Committee, waive full reading, and read by title only and continue to the next regular meeting for adoption; and 2) Review a resolution approving the bylaws for the Galt Youth Commission, and the bylaws as attached, and continue to the next regular meeting for adoption. 2. SUBJECT: Ordinances regarding use of parks, use of skate parks, and camping; and resolution establishing additional rules and regulations for city parks. STAFF REPORT: Rudolph RECOMMENDED ACTION: 1) Introduce an ordinance, waive the first reading, and GALT CITY COUNCIL AGENDA REGULAR MEETING OF NOVEMBER 18, 2014 PAGE 3 read by title only an ordinance repealing and replacing Chapter 12.12 of the Galt Municipal Code regarding use of parks, and repealing Section 9.12.025 regarding city parks curfews; 2) Introduce an ordinance, waive the first reading, and read by title only an ordinance repealing and replacing Chapter 9.37 of the Galt Municipal Code regarding the use of skate parks; 3) Introduce an ordinance, waive the first reading, and read by title only an ordinance adopting Chapter 9.52 of the Galt Municipal Code regarding camping; and 4) Review the resolution establishing additional Rules and Regulations for City Parks, provide comments and revisions to City staff, and continue to the next meeting for adoption. HUMAN RESOURCES: 3. SUBJECT: Approval of the City of Galt Americans with Disabilities Self Evaluation and Transition Plan. STAFF REPORT: Islas RECOMMENDED ACTION: Adopt a resolution approving the City of Galt Americans with Disabilities (ADA) Self Evaluation and Transition Plan. Part 2 Part 3 4. SUBJECT: Approval of deferred compensation plan documents and service provider. STAFF REPORT: Islas RECOMMENDED ACTION: Adopt a resolution approving the deferred compensation plan documents, approving TIAA-CREF Financial Services as a service provider and authorizing the Deferred Compensation Committee to administer the plan. PUBLIC WORKS DEPARTMENT: 5. SUBJECT: Walnut Avenue/Elk Hills Drive four way stop request update. STAFF REPORT: Winkler RECOMMENDED ACTION: Receive a report regarding the Walnut Avenue/Elk Hills Drive four way stop request and provide further direction to staff, if desired. H. COMMUNICATION I.
